千锋教育-做有情怀、有良心、有品质的职业教育机构

400-811-9990
手机站
千锋教育

千锋学习站 | 随时随地免费学

千锋教育

扫一扫进入千锋手机站

领取全套视频
千锋教育

关注千锋学习站小程序
随时随地免费学习课程

上海
  • 北京
  • 郑州
  • 武汉
  • 成都
  • 西安
  • 沈阳
  • 广州
  • 南京
  • 深圳
  • 大连
  • 青岛
  • 杭州
  • 重庆

shutil模块python的操作方法

匿名提问者 2023-10-17 11:58:29

shutil模块python的操作方法

我要提问

推荐答案

  shutil模块还提供了丰富的功能来操作目录,以下是一些示例:

Python教程

  1.创建目录:使用shutil.os.mkdir(path)函数创建新目录。

  import shutil

  new_directory = "new_directory"

  shutil.os.mkdir(new_directory)

 

  2.删除目录:使用shutil.rmtree(path)函数删除目录及其所有内容。

  import shutil

  directory_to_delete = "directory_to_delete"

  shutil.rmtree(directory_to_delete)

 

  3.复制目录:shutil模块允许你复制整个目录,包括其中的所有文件和子目录。

  import shutil

  src_directory = "source_directory"

  dst_directory = "destination_directory"

  shutil.copytree(src_directory, dst_directory)

 

  4.移动目录:使用shutil.move(src, dst)函数来移动目录。

  import shutil

  src_directory = "source_directory"

  dst_directory = "destination_directory"

  shutil.move(src_directory, dst_directory)

 

  5.获取目录内容列表:你可以使用shutil.os.listdir(path)获取目录中的文件和子目录列表。

  import shutil

  directory_path = "my_directory"

  contents = shutil.os.listdir(directory_path)

  print("Directory contents:", contents)

 

猜你喜欢LIKE

shutil模块python的操作方法

2023-10-17

java时间戳转为时间的方法怎么操作

2023-10-17

java文件写入不覆盖怎么操作

2023-10-17

最新文章NEW

java list排序字母数字

2023-10-17

java文件写入乱码怎么办

2023-10-17

java导出word模板的方法

2023-10-17